Benesch is seeking a Roadway Project Engineer II to join our Civil Roadway team in Raleigh, North Carolina. This role involves collaborating with senior staff to deliver transportation projects and contributing to the company's strategic growth initiatives. The position offers a hybrid work schedule, combining in-office and remote work.

The Roadway Project Engineer II will work independently within a design team to execute project work plans, ensuring projects remain under budget and on schedule. Responsibilities include mentoring junior staff, interacting with clients, agencies, and other project stakeholders, and representing Benesch at industry and professional engagement events.

Candidates must have a minimum of 10 years of diverse and progressive civil transportation design experience and hold a B.S. Degree in Civil Engineering. A Professional Engineer (PE) license in North Carolina is required, or the ability to obtain licensure through comity within one year. Proficiency in MicroStation and Geopak is essential, with experience in OpenRoads Designer preferred. Strong organizational skills and a proven track record of adhering to design budgets and schedules are also necessary.
